@@ -4,6 +4,92 @@ All notable changes to this project will be documented in this file.
44
55## Unreleased
66
7+ ## 0.3.0
8+
9+ Released 2019-12-13
10+
11+ #### :rocket : (Enhancement)
12+ * ` opentelemetry-core ` , ` opentelemetry-node ` , ` opentelemetry-plugin-dns ` , ` opentelemetry-plugin-document-load ` , ` opentelemetry-plugin-grpc ` , ` opentelemetry-plugin-postgres ` , ` opentelemetry-plugin-redis ` , ` opentelemetry-tracing ` , ` opentelemetry-types `
13+ * [ #569 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/569 ) chore: allow parent span to be null
14+ * ` opentelemetry-plugin-document-load `
15+ * [ #546 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/546 ) chore: fixing issue when metric time is 0 in document-load plugin
16+ * [ #469 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/469 ) chore: fixing problem with load event and performance for loadend
17+ * ` opentelemetry-plugin-http ` , ` opentelemetry-plugin-https `
18+ * [ #548 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/548 ) fix(plugin-http): adapt to current @types/node
19+ * Other
20+ * [ #510 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/510 ) chore(circleci): remove duplicate compile step
21+ * [ #514 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/514 ) ci: enumerate caching paths manually
22+ * [ #470 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/470 ) chore: remove examples from lerna packages
23+ * ` opentelemetry-core ` , ` opentelemetry-metrics ` , ` opentelemetry-types `
24+ * [ #507 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/507 ) feat: direct calling of metric instruments
25+ * [ #517 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/517 ) chore: update dependencies gts and codecov
26+ * [ #497 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/497 ) chore: bump typescript version to ^3.7.2
27+ * ` opentelemetry-metrics `
28+ * [ #475 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/475 ) add shutdown method on MetricExporter interface
29+ * ` opentelemetry-core ` , ` opentelemetry-plugin-document-load ` , ` opentelemetry-tracing ` , ` opentelemetry-web `
30+ * [ #466 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/466 ) chore: fixing coverage for karma using istanbul
31+
32+ #### :bug : (Bug Fix)
33+ * ` opentelemetry-exporter-jaeger `
34+ * [ #609 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/609 ) Jaeger no flush interval
35+ * ` opentelemetry-plugin-dns `
36+ * [ #613 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/613 ) fix(plugin-dns): remove from default plugin list
37+ * ` opentelemetry-plugin-http `
38+ * [ #589 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/589 ) fix(plugin-http): correct handling of WHATWG urls
39+ * [ #580 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/580 ) fix(plugin-http): http.url attribute
40+ * ` opentelemetry-shim-opentracing `
41+ * [ #577 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/577 ) fix: add missing ` main ` in package.json
42+ * ` opentelemetry-exporter-zipkin `
43+ * [ #526 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/526 ) fix: zipkin-exporter: don't export after shutdown
44+ * ` opentelemetry-plugin-grpc `
45+ * [ #487 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/487 ) fix(grpc): use correct supportedVersions
46+ * ` opentelemetry-core `
47+ * [ #472 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/472 ) fix(core): add missing semver dependency
48+
49+ #### :books : (Refine Doc)
50+ * Other
51+ * [ #574 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/574 ) chore: add CHANGELOG.md
52+ * [ #575 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/575 ) Add exporter guide
53+ * [ #534 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/534 ) feat: add redis plugin example
54+ * [ #562 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/562 ) chore(web-example): Added a README for the existing example
55+ * [ #537 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/537 ) examples(tracing): add multi exporter example
56+ * [ #484 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/484 ) chore: update README for new milestones
57+ * ` opentelemetry-plugin-mongodb-core `
58+ * [ #564 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/564 ) docs: add usage for mongodb-core plugin #543 )
59+ * ` opentelemetry-metrics `
60+ * [ #490 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/490 ) chore: update metrics README
61+ * ` opentelemetry-plugin-redis `
62+ * [ #551 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/551 ) chore: fix minor typo
63+ * ` opentelemetry-exporter-prometheus `
64+ * [ #521 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/521 ) chore: update prometheus exporter readme with usage and links
65+ * ` opentelemetry-types `
66+ * [ #512 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/512 ) chore: minor name change
67+ * ` opentelemetry-plugin-postgres `
68+ * [ #473 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/473 ) chore(plugin): postgres-pool plugin skeleton
69+
70+ #### :sparkles : (Feature)
71+ * ` opentelemetry-core ` , ` opentelemetry-exporter-collector `
72+ * [ #552 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/552 ) Collector exporter
73+ * ` opentelemetry-node ` , ` opentelemetry-plugin-mysql `
74+ * [ #525 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/525 ) feat: mysql support
75+ * ` opentelemetry-plugin-redis `
76+ * [ #503 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/503 ) feat(plugin): implement redis plugin
77+ * ` opentelemetry-plugin-mongodb-core `
78+ * [ #205 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/205 ) feat: add mongodb plugin
79+ * ` opentelemetry-exporter-prometheus `
80+ * [ #483 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/483 ) feat: Add prometheus exporter
81+ * ` opentelemetry-metrics `
82+ * [ #500 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/500 ) feat: add ConsoleMetricExporter
83+ * [ #468 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/468 ) feat: validate metric names
84+ * ` opentelemetry-scope-zone-peer-dep ` , ` opentelemetry-scope-zone ` , ` opentelemetry-web `
85+ * [ #461 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/461 ) feat(scope-zone): new scope manager to support async operations in web
86+ * ` opentelemetry-core ` , ` opentelemetry-plugin-document-load `
87+ * [ #477 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/477 ) feat(traceparent): setting parent span from server
88+ * ` opentelemetry-core ` , ` opentelemetry-metrics ` , ` opentelemetry-types `
89+ * [ #463 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/463 ) feat: implement labelset
90+ * ` opentelemetry-metrics ` , ` opentelemetry-types `
91+ * [ #437 ] ( https://github.com/open-telemetry/opentelemetry-js/pull/437 ) feat(metrics): add registerMetric and getMetrics
92+
793## 0.2.0
894
995Released 2019-11-04
0 commit comments